Not much in it for txt2coords():

txt2coords = function(txt) {
  # helper function to document...
  coords_split = stringr::str_split(txt, pattern = " |,")[[1]]
  matrix(as.numeric(coords_split),
         ncol = 2,
         byrow = TRUE)
}
txt2coords2 = function(txt) {
  if(is.na(txt)){
    return(NULL)
  }
  coords_split = stringr::str_split(txt, pattern = " |,")[[1]]
  coords_split = matrix(as.numeric(coords_split),
                        ncol = 2,
                        byrow = TRUE)
  sf::st_linestring(coords_split)
}
txt2coords3 = function(txt) {
  # helper function to document...
  coords_split = stringi::stri_split(txt, regex = " |,")
  matrix(as.numeric(coords_split[[1]]), ncol = 2, byrow = TRUE)
}

f = system.file(package = "cyclestreets", "extdata/journey.json")
obj = jsonlite::read_json(f, simplifyVector = TRUE)
txt = obj$marker$`@attributes`$points[2]
c1 = txt2coords(txt)
c2 = txt2coords2(txt)
c3 = txt2coords3(txt)
waldo::compare(c1, c2)
#> `old` is a double vector (-1.54408, -1.54399, -1.54336, -1.54331, -1.54329, ...)
#> `new` is an S3 object of class <XY/LINESTRING/sfg>, a double vector
waldo::compare(c1, c3)
#> ✔ No differences
# `old` is a double vector (-1.54408, -1.54399, -1.54336, -1.54331, -1.54329, ...)
# `new` is an S3 object of class <XY/LINESTRING/sfg>, a double vector
bench::mark(check = FALSE,
  c1 = txt2coords(txt),
  c2 = txt2coords2(txt),
  c3 = txt2coords2(txt)
)
#> # A tibble: 3 × 6
#>   expression      min   median `itr/sec` mem_alloc `gc/sec`
#>   <bch:expr> <bch:tm> <bch:tm>     <dbl> <bch:byt>    <dbl>
#> 1 c1           11.2µs   12.3µs    75749.      42KB     37.9
#> 2 c2           17.2µs     19µs    49033.    29.1KB     39.3
#> 3 c3           17.2µs   19.2µs    48149.      264B     43.4

Created on 2023-07-08 with reprex v2.0.2
